Students in the Curriculum & Instruction program at Wayne State College pursue a Master degree. Graduates earn a median salary of $64,269 four years after completion, near the national median for this field. Graduates typically enter roles like Instructional Coordinators and Education Teachers, Postsecondary. The median salary for Instructional Coordinators is $74,620. Approximately 70 students completed this program in the most recent reporting year.
